APP下载

广播电台基于LBS技术实现受众精准定位

2012-02-08赵军

中国传媒科技 2012年13期
关键词:广播电台终端定位

文|赵军

广播电台基于LBS技术实现受众精准定位

文|赵军

传统的调频无线广播,由于采用的是模拟广播式无线发射技术,故此在这种技术模式下的广播,电台与受众之间是没有直接联系的。所以,需要了解受众的信息,只能通过第三方调查公司依据统计学原理进行统计分析,从而了解受众的情况。由于受到调查方法的局限,故数据的精确度受到抽样例子、操作流程、计算方法等各种因素的影响。通过移动互联网终端收听广播节目,结合LBS技术手段,即可实现受众的精准定位,再结合其他相关的操作记录,从而能直接了解受众行为,这将给传统广播受众研究带来一种新的尝试与创新。

为了实现这个目的,佛山电台从2009年底,开始进行移动互联网广播电台手机客户端的设计与开发,并以此为核心成功完成“广播与新媒体应用播出营运平台”项目的建设。该项目使受众通过手机终端进行广播的收听时,终端自动读取受众地理位置信息并经过后台数据库LBS数据分析处理,真正实现了受众地理位置的“精准定位”,并可以根据此数据开展针对性很强的节目管理及广告市场经营开拓。

LBS技术原理

LBS(Location Based Service,基于位置的服务),它是通过移动运营商的无线电通讯网络(如GSM网、CDMA网)或外部定位方式(如GPS)获取移动终端用户的位置信息(地理坐标,或大地坐标),在GIS(Geographic Information System,地理信息系统)平台的支持下,为用户提供相应服务的一种增值业务。

目前技术上实现移动定位的方案可以划分为三大类:基于移动网络的技术方案、基于移动终端的技术方案和两者结合的混合定位方案。

第一类,基于移动网络的技术方案

基于移动通信网络的技术方案有多种可以采用,例如:COO(Cell Of Origin)起源蜂窝小区定位技术、AOA(Arrival Of Angle)到达角定位技术、TOA(Time Of Arrival)抵达时间定位技术、TDOA(Time Difference Of Arrival)抵达时间差异定位技术、E-OTD(Enhanced-Observed Time Difference)增强型观测时间差定位技术等。

另外,还有WIFI无线网络定位技术。这种方法跟通信基站定位类似,手机搜索出这些WIFI设备的全球唯一标识码(MAC)后,发送到远程定位服务器进行运算定位。这种方法虽然定位精度一般,但是只要有WIFI信号也可以实现室内定位。

第二类:基于移动终端的技术方案

该类技术主要有GPS定位技术。GPS定位技术是通过移动终端GPS接收模块,对卫星定位数据进行计算,从而确定移动终端的位置信息 ( 包括经度、纬度、速度、时间、轨迹等参数)。这种技术只适宜室外空旷地使用,初次冷启动定位时间较长(2-10分钟),高精度,误差在10-50米左右。

第三类:混合定位方案,即前两类技术的结合

典型应用就是A-GPS(Assistant Global Positioning System辅助全球卫星定位系统)定位技术。这种方法移动终端本身并不对位置信息进行计算,而是将 GPS 的位置信息数据传给移动通信网络,由网络的定位服务器进行位置计算,同时移动网络按照GPS的参考网络所产生的辅助数据,如差分校正数据、卫星运行状态等传递给手机,并从数据库中查出移动终端的近似位置传给移动终端。这时移动终端可以很快捕捉到GPS信号,这样的首次捕获时间将大大减小,一般仅需几秒的时间,无需像GPS的首次捕获时间可能要2-10分钟。这种方法需要远程定位服务器和通信网络的支持。

传统的调频广播在节目播出时,往往对于其受众的情况是模糊不清的,难以开展更多有价值的营运活动。而应用专门开发的智能手机客户端(例如iphone app客户端)进行广播电台节目的收听,通过LBS 技术的应用和后台数据分析系统,就可以容易获取受众的具体地理位置等信息,从而实现了受众从“虚拟”到“实体”、从“模糊”到“精准”的转变,使传统广播电台在节目播出管理及经营突破方面具备新的手段实现新的飞跃。

混合定位是定位技术的发展一个方向。它结合了基于终端的定位技术和基于网络的定位技术的优点,使定位更加的精确和可靠。辅助GPS定位技术和通用的基于网络的定位技术相结合将是LBS系统中定位的主流。

基于LBS定位技术,广播电台通过移动智能终端进行地理位置数据的采集,然后通过后台数据库进行LBS数据的处理,从而实现了广播电台受众的精准定位。

实现广播受众精准定位的工作原理简介

基于LBS定位技术,为实现受众的精准定位,首先需要在移动终端中读取设备当前的经纬度等参数,通过3G或WIFI无线网络连接将数据存到数据库,再通过后台数据分析处理系统对LBS数据进行分析,从而实现受众位置的精准定位。

移动智能终端LBS技术应用的实现

要实现广播受众的精准定位,首先必须通过智能手机等移动终端获取当前的地理位置经纬度,故此在开发应用程序时需要获取经纬度的能力。移动智能终端平台有多种,在广播电台主流应用中以安卓Android和苹果ios平台为主。

以安卓手机开发为例,Android软件结构自底向上由以下四个层次组成:Linux内核层、Android运行时库和其他库层、应用框架层、应用程序层,如右图所示。

第1层次和第2层次之间,从Linux操作系统的角度来来看,是内核空间与用户空间的分界线,第1层次运行于内核空间,第2、3、4层次运行于用户空间。第2层次和第3层次之间,是本地代码层和Java代码层的接口。第3层次和第4层次之间,是Android的系统API的接口,对于Android应用程序的开发,第3层次以下的内容是不可见的,仅考虑系统API即可。所以,在Android上开发LBS应用获取经纬度信息,不管是GPS定位、移动小区定位还是WIFI定位,均可利用系统提供的API(android.location)即可方便获得移动终端当前的位置信息。在智能终端,通过系统自带的Setting应用,进入到“Location & security”,可以看到在“My Locaiton”下,有“Use wireless networks”和“Use GPS satellites”,选择启用后,就能获得使用者的当前位置信息。

通过以上手段,即可实现移动终端当前的地理位置数据的读取。然后,通过http请求的方式,将此数据存传回后台LBS数据库中,以备数据分析处理系统进行处理。

后台LBS数据的处理分析

通过手机客户端地理位置信息的采集,在后台数据库上记录了每一个手机客户端的详细数据。一个典型的数据串格式如下:

113.72.93.105|iphone|112.900 223E 23.129831N|weiboguest@126.com|924|无节目|星星相惜|邱静访谈

通过数据格式分析,可以看到,数据不仅包含了当时移动终端所处位置的经纬度,还包含了详细的访问IP、机型、微博帐号、访问的节目名称等操作记录,通过对这些数据进行处理分析,就可以得到广播电台所需要的各种分析要求,例如,受众所处位置、某档节目的受众分布、节目的收听波形分析等。为了满足以上要求,主要解决以下两个问题:

1、地理位置数据库的建立。

通过移动终端采集的数据记录上有详细的经纬度,还需要与实际的行政区划地理位置数据进行比对才能真正实现受众位置的精准定位。通过实际对比,商业上的可用GIS数据出于版权保护或费用过高等原因,直接用于电台应用都不太现实。故此经过对电台实际业务分析后,我们认为目前广播电台要求的地理位置数据库不需要太精细。从精确度可以基本分成五层,第一层街道级别;第二层行政区级别;第三层市级别;第四层省级别;第五层境外级别。所以,采用自行建立地理位置数据库的方法。

建立地理位置信息库,一般有两种思路。一是通过地理信息点与地区的栅格化数据库进行对比,得到地理信息点所在的栅格,从而确定地区信息。二是通过计算地理信息点与地理信息库内的数据点的距离,比对后得到距离最近数据点,从而得出其对应的地区信息。两种方法各有优缺点,需要根据实际情况来采用。栅格化的方式需要有庞大的地理信息库为基础,还需要较高的硬件设备,不便建立,费用较高。地理数据点的方式可以通过逐步建库的方式来实现,重要地区重点布点,周边地区分散布点。这样,可以在获得足够数据精度的条件下,大幅节省费用。比较之后我们采用地理数据点的方式实现人工建立地理位置数据库。通过实际应用,自行建立的地理位置数据库完全可以满足使用。当然,投入更多的人力财力,建立更多更精细的地理位置数据点,将可以大大提高定位的精度。

2、LBS数据的处理。

在具备了地理位置数据库之后,就可开始LBS数据的处理:

(1)从智能手机等移动终端等得到精准的GPS地理位置信息。

(2)通过经纬度信息与数据库内存储的地区信息进行比对。

(3)简化地球为一圆形,两个地理信息的距离可以看成是球面上两点间大圆的距离。

(4)通过数学方式的转换,将大圆的距离问题转换为两坐标点间的直线距离。

(5)通过数学的角度等运行,可以得出两坐标点间的最短距离。

(6)对所有的距离进行排序,得出与移动终端最近的地理信息点。

(7)从地理信息点的地区信息得出移动终端的位置。

通过将以上的计算方式转化为计算机程序,在后台数据管理系统中实现得到用户的地理信息数据。处理系统还设置了输出KML地图数据的功能,可以将受众的经纬度输出成KML格式的文件,便于交Google Earth进行处理,直接在Google地图上标注受众位置。由于这种方式是直接将经纬度标注出来,所以拥有很高的定位精度,真正实现受众精确的定位。

通过以上工作步骤,即可基本实现广播受众的精准定位。图1为后台数据分析处理系统工作截图,图2主要呈现的是在2012年1月一周的总体节目点击数量,通过LBS技术应用,可以清晰了解这些访问的来源地。而图3图4,是根据电台自身业务的需要进行更加详细的受众来源地分析,从而获取更多的受众信息。图5图6为通过输出kml格式文件,经过Google Earth进行地理位置标注的访问者位置。

图1 后台数据分析处理系统工作截图

图2 一周受众收听节目点击数量图

图3 一周佛山市五区受众收听节目点击数量图

图4 一周佛山市顺德区八个镇受众收听节目点击数量图

图5 经Google Earth进行地理位置标注的访问者位置(粗图)

图6 经Google Earth进行地理位置标注的访问者位置(细图)

除了受众地理位置信息的分析处理,通过更多智能终端数据的分析,还可以分析受众的收听习惯、节目的收听率等广播电台非常关心的重要信息,使之成为广播电台的节目管理和广告经营的一种新手段,甚至可以推动广播模式的创新。

小结

广播电台在移动终端上开发基于LBS技术的应用系统,除了可以有效地打破了传统广播覆盖范围有限、无法与受众实现真正的联动外,还可以实现受众位置数据分析,从而为广播节目的管理,广告市场的经营带来好处。但是,这种方式还存在一定局限性。

1、由于使用智能终端(例如3G手机)收听广播,还存在上网费用、终端价格较高、操作较复杂等问题,相对普通收音机来说收听门槛较高,故此在受众数量上还有待提高。

2、作为一种新的技术手段和节目收听模式,广播电台自身还存在认识不足的问题,故此客户端软件用户数量不足,进而使访问数据量偏少,因此其数据分析结果暂不能与传统调研公司相比。

3、出于保护个人隐私,很多智能终端用户可以主动关闭定位服务,所以,造成部分受众数据中没有经纬度,从而降低了有效数据的使用。

当然,以上各种问题都可以通过广播电台大力宣传推广终端软件的使用、奖励注册用户等手段吸引广大受众主动使用智能终端并开放定位服务,而且随着我国3G网络和智能终端应用的不断普及,新型广播收听模式将不断被认知,可以预见,通过移动互联网进行广播收听将成为除无线调频外一种有力的补充手段。所以通过LBS技术实现受众的精准定位和其他广播业务分析,将是一种很有前途和创新的广播研究与分析应用。

book=0,ebook=131

佛山人民广播电台技术中心)

猜你喜欢

广播电台终端定位
定位的奥秘
《导航定位与授时》征稿简则
X美术馆首届三年展:“终端〉_How Do We Begin?”
Smartrail4.0定位和控制
广播电台播控系统的监测技术研究
AOIP技术在广播电台播控系统中的应用分析
银行业对外开放再定位
通信控制服务器(CCS)维护终端的设计与实现
探究微信平台在广播电台的应用
GSM-R手持终端呼叫FAS失败案例分析